Your Learning Toddler

Parents are toddler’s first teachers. The home is the first learning environment for every toddler. During the first three years, the learning toddler makes leaps and bounds in his development. He develops physically, mentally, social-emotionally and spiritually. Parents can do a great deal to cultivate and lay the foundation for a toddler’s love for learning.


Toddler Learning Behavior

Toddlers are great with hands-on approach to learning. They need lots of developmentally-appropriate toddler learning toys as well as non-toys. They want to learn to do things for themselves. Pouring, scooping, tying shoe-laces, buttoning and opening doors are among the many skills toddlers eagerly want to learn. Play is a child’s work. Your learning toddlers are not ready for formal teaching.

Toddlers have no wait time. Their inability to give in or to adapt often upsets them. There are two factors which have strong influence on the way toddlers react to the complexities of this age:
* Their personality
* How parents manage their behavior
While there is little that can be done about the first factor, there is much parents can do to make the difficult toddler age more bearable for both parents and child.

Toddlers are self-learners. They learn to turn, crawl, stand and walk all by themselves. They can also learn to talk, read and write by themselves. If they are allowed the time and freedom, they will be able to do things for themselves easily. They need support and encouragement. They do not want parents to rush them into learning something that is not appropriate developmentally.


Parents Role in Toddler Learning

The role of parents is to give their learning toddler time and encouragement to master their own problems. Instead of rushing to help your toddler to wear his shoes, it is better for you to give him time to work it out and tell him that you understand his struggle. Patience and practice will surely boost your child’s confidence.

Parents can provide a safe and interesting environment in which the learning toddlers can work on their skills like walking, talking, running and climbing. They are great explorers. Everything in their environment is a possibility to be used as a tool for their learning. Therefore, it is important that parents take the necessary steps to ensure children’s safety and health while they explore freely and learn at their own pace.


Teaching Your Toddler

Look around your house. Where is your toddler’s favorite hideaway or his favorite spot to play? Safe proof the spaces where you toddler will be spending his time. This way you can relax and enjoy your special times together. Make sure the environment is also well-ventilated and well-lit.

Get organized with low shelves and storage boxes. You can label them according to your child’s interests or childhood developmental aspects such as physical, language, social or intellectual play. It is easier for both of you and your child when the things are carefully stored away in different storage boxes. Your child can be quite independent even in cleaning or tidying up.
